The National Museum of the Royal Navy as "NMRN Operations" is inviting experienced and specialist suppliers to tender for inclusion in a new Open Framework Agreement for the provision of design and production services.
This framework will be accessible across all areas of the museum group and is being established in line with the 2025 procurement regulations.
The framework will allow for the appointment of multiple suppliers and periodic reopening to allow new entrants under the regulations of the Open Framework set out in the tender pack.
The tender pack will include the scope of services, these will include but are not limited to: Graphic design (print and digital), print and signage production, display graphic design, development of creative for campaigns, Animation and illustration.
As well as Digital asset creation (e.g., social media, web graphics).
The framework intends to allow Departments across the NMRN Group to use the framework when requiring design and production services.
Suppliers must demonstrate proven experience in delivering creative services for public or cultural organisations.
Capacity to deliver high-quality work to tight deadlines, and a commitment to accessibility and sustainability standards.
All the information for this tender including the fifteen (15) lots is within the tender pack listed in this advert.
